Picturesque mountain village, some houses date from 1400’s. Spectacular hill walking, hiking. Good footpaths. Switzerland is expensive but this area is worth a visit.
Easy access to Aletsch glacier for excellent ski ing. The cable car is a short drive, massive car park available or there is a regular bus service
